Nagraj Kapas Seeds Requirements:
Requirements | Details |
Season | June to July |
Seed Rate | 2 to 3 packets per acre |
Sowing Depth | 2 to 3 cm |
Soil | Deep, fertile, well-drained loam to heavy soil with good moisture retention |
Soil pH | 5.8 to 8.0 pH |
Sunlight | 6 to 8 hours of complete sunlight |
Temperature | 24°C to 32°C |
Water | Regular |
Fertilizer | NPK or Organic Fertilizer |
Krishna Nagraj Cotton Sowing Tips:
For improved germination, keep the Nagraj cotton seeds soaked in water for 2 to 6 hours.
Ensure the soil is well-loosened during land preparation before planting the seeds.
Make sure the Nagraj cotton seeds get enough sunlight and water.
